Brian Boswell, U.S. World Cup Semifinal Analysis

Ajax America Women Coach Brian Boswell returns to provide 100 Percent Soccer with a match analysis of the U.S.-Brazil semifinal:

The U.S. have been preparing for this game since the end of the 2003 World Cup, whereas the Brazilian team disbanded that year and did not come together until earlier this year for the Pan American Games.
